Output e70607b60fcfb021204cb84befb57b9ace71640601baf2abe69ca6b5862e66a7:3

value
310362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f88f256eb1c946311e134184e0cac42205e7460 OP_EQUAL
address
3GEZRGGZxMpzZaijEUaQiM3oFgKb8EmAoV
transaction
e70607b60fcfb021204cb84befb57b9ace71640601baf2abe69ca6b5862e66a7
spent
true